History
Built Year 1920's
Builder Mitch Lacco 
Designer Mitch Lacco 
History Built at Queenscliff during the 1920s to win Williamstown to Portarlington race and did. Later came adrift and was wrecked, then restored as a fishing boat working from Geelong for 20 years. Recently restored by Brett Almond Completely restored by Brett Almond Feb 2005.
